Utilizing hollow cone or flat fan nozzles is essential for aerial application as it maximizes the distribution of the pesticide over the targeted area. These types of nozzles are designed to create a fine spray pattern that helps ensure even coverage on the surface of the water or vegetation. Hollow cone nozzles produce a spray that is effective for targeting specific areas due to their cone-shaped pattern, allowing for better penetration and coverage, especially in dense foliage or aquatic environments.

In aerial applications, achieving uniform coverage is crucial because it minimizes the risk of pesticide runoff and enhances the effectiveness of pest control measures. The correct nozzle type also aids in reducing drift, ensuring that the product reaches its intended target without adversely affecting the surrounding environment.
